Being from a small country but with a number of active users that makes the first league mostly interesting, I do think it would be strange if someone from half way around the world, who has never lived in or been to Japan would become and be labeled as the Japan Champion. I think the Japan Champion should be from Japan.

On the other hand, I don't like the idea of a separate universe of play. I think the second teams should be in the same universe with the same player pools and with the opportunity to get to B3.

So, I think the only solution is to create some new "Seconds" countries for the second teams. I'd be happy to play in an "Asia Seconds" league or however else you want to organize the teams and second countries.
